Job Description

Summary: WSP USA is a leading engineering and professional services firm dedicated to serving local communities. They are seeking an Early Career Mineral Processing Engineer to assist with process development, research, design, and analysis of mineral processing plants, ensuring quality and safety standards are met. Responsibilities: - Support a variety of engineering tasks with the goal of developing technical, social, and ethical skills - Assist with project research, and preliminary design calculations and analysis - Support preparation of final design plans, special provisions, and cost estimates - Assist in collecting and maintaining project documentation - Complete training on assigned tasks - Exercise responsible and ethical decision-making regarding company funds, resources and conduct, and adhere to WSP’s Code of Conduct and related policies and procedures - Perform additional responsibilities as required by business needs - Occasional travel may be required depending on project-specific requirements Required Qualifications: - Degree in Chemical, Metallurgical, or Mineral Process Engineering with an anticipated graduation date no later than May 2026 - 0 to 1 years of relevant post education experience, early career engineers may be considered - Demonstrated interest in extractive metallurgical process engineering and have a strong desire to advance skills related to WSP's work and projects - Excellent research skills with analytical mindset - Competent interpersonal and communication skills when interacting with others, expressing ideas effectively and professionally to an engineering and non-engineering audience - Proficient self-leadership with attention to detail, multi-tasking, and prioritization of responsibilities in a dynamic work environment - Ability to work independently under general supervision, as well as part of a team to meet business objectives - Basic proficiency with technical writing, office automation, software, spreadsheets, technology, and tools - Proven track record of upholding workplace safety and ability to abide by WSP's health, safety and drug/alcohol and harassment policies - Ability to work schedules conducive to project-specific requirements that may extend beyond the typical workweek - Authorization to work in the United States Preferred Qualifications: - Engineer in Training Certification, or ability to obtain EIT within a year of hire - Prior internship related to the degree of study and the specific engineering discipline, desired, but not required - A member of and/or actively participate in local professional practice organizations - Experience in process design, material and energy balances, Process Flow Diagrams (PFDs), cost estimation (CAPEX/OPEX), capital budgeting (ROI/IRR/NPV) - Exposure to a wide range of process operations that may include crushing, grinding, screening, hydro classification, air classification, gravity concentration, magnetic separation, dense media separation, sensor-based sorting, flotation, leaching, heap leaching, pressure oxidation, solvent extraction, electrowinning, thickening, clarification, filtration, drying, mixing, feeding, pumping, bulk solids handling and pneumatic conveying - Authorization to work in the United States Required Skills: Chemical Engineering, Metallurgical Engineering, Mineral Processing Engineering Important Skills: Process Design, Analytical Skills, Technical Writing Nice-to-Have Skills: Self-leadership, Multi-tasking, Prioritization, Workplace Safety, Ethical Decision-making, Project Documentation, Cost Estimation, Process Operations, EIT Certification, Interpersonal Skills, Communication Skills, Teamwork, Attention to Detail Benefits: Coverage related to medical, dental, vision, disability, and life, Retirement savings, Paid sick leave, Paid vacation (or other personal time), Paid parental leave, Paid time off for purposes of bereavement, voting, and/or attendance at naturalization proceedings
